Bray Talks Tech

Tim Bray is truly one of the guys that just keeps the Internet humming along. He's the co-author of the XML 1.0 spec, and co-chairs the IETF AtomPub Working Group. His main job these days, however, is to evangelize developer technologies inside Sun, and to get the word out to developers about technologies being developed by Sun. He describes himself as a "two-way evangelist." John Dorsey had a talk with him at RailsConf2007.
